Shreveport Benefits Most From Gambling

20 April 2005

OUISIANA -- As reported by the Advocate: "The 14 riverboats and New Orleans land-based casino pumped more than $3.6 billion into the Louisiana economy during fiscal 2004, according to a study released Thursday by the Casino Association of Louisiana.

"The study, which was conducted by LSU economist Loren Scott, found that Shreveport/Bossier remained the biggest beneficiary from riverboat gambling. The five casinos created $1.6 billion in business sales and more than 20,000 jobs in metro Shreveport.

"...Seventy-four percent of the people who gamble in Shreveport/Bossier come from outside Louisiana, mainly Texas. That compares to a 1998 study that found out-of-state residents made up 44 percent of the gamblers in Shreveport/Bossier.

"This dependence on out-of-state visitors leaves the casinos near Louisiana's western border vulnerable.

"...In contrast to the bustling number of visitors who come to Shreveport, Baton Rouge's two local casinos almost entirely attract local gamblers.
